Bio
Joseph Messing is a singer songwriter living in Chicago, Illinois. Though a musician his entire life, he first began performing his own writing in Chicago in 2001. At that time he developed a very strong following and performed throughout the city leading up to the release of his self-produced CD, Confessions in Verse. After the release of his CD in 2003, he was joined by Dan Huber, a classically trained bassist playing both upright bass and electric bass. The pair went on to perform with several different variations of band members over a two year period, and after a long hiatus, have now settled on their bread and butter, the personal connection of the singer/songwriter format. The music is primarily written by Joseph Messing and covers a wide range of both musical genres and topics. Messing's strengths lie in strong, emotive vocals and identifiable lyrics. Huber compliments this presence with a grace and flexibility which truly show his talent. The changes the pair have endured bring a fresh depth and meaning to their latest music, showing that the duo has only begun to show their capabilities.
